首页
AI Coding
NEW
沸点
课程
直播
活动
AI刷题
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
会员
登录
注册
前端白小纯
掘友等级
获得徽章 0
动态
文章
专栏
沸点
收藏集
关注
作品
赞
117
文章 117
沸点 0
赞
117
返回
|
搜索文章
最新
热门
4.基于Umi4使用ProForm、ProTable、组件封装
1.ProForm表单使用 1.1父组件 index.js 1.2子组件 baseForm.js 1.3封装的CProInputToSearch组件 2.ProTable使用 2.1封装单选列表
3.基于Umi4多tabs缓存标签,展示路由导航页面
需求1:根据点开的路由页面,缓存标签页面,达到切换tabs时缓存页面数据,比如未完成的表单。 需求2:标签页面第一个标签为路由导航页面,根据顶部header路由切换
2.umi4 默认配置、代理配置、启动配置、页面缓存配置
umi4 默认配置、代理配置、启动配置、页面缓存配置,其中路由文件没有导入,自己配置。安装缓存依赖,config配置依赖
1.在请求拦截器中,去除参数空格
在请求拦截器里统一去掉空格,浏览器不会对请求报文数据结构做任何操作,排查问题时,需要去请求拦截器中寻找答案,获取去axios中是否有操作
基于Umi根据权限设置动态路由_顶部Menu_侧边栏
1.在app.js中全局监听路由变化 2.在router.js中设置动态路由middleRouter 3.middleRouter的层级不固定,功能包含路由权限和侧边栏是否展示
基于umi配置头部路由,侧边路由及权限
1.配置router.js 2.配置commonHeader.js 配置commonSlider.js 4.commonLayout.js 5.捕捉路由信息 6.commonModal.js
使用XRender(4)_动态设置配置项
1.当选中的画布组件变化时 onCanvasSelect 1.1 需求:因为在实际操作过程中,拖拽后的组件id是必须存在且不能重复,这个随机id值不能作为和后端交互的标识,需要自定义一个组件
使用XRender(3)_获取表单schema值和自定义初始配置项
1.获取全局配置、通用配置、左右侧栏配置 拿到默认配置文件后,将配置复制到本地,本地维护配置文件 2.获取当前表单的schema值 3.根据后端返回的数据,渲染右侧组件设置
react-beautiful-dnd(3)交互demo测试
1.动态数量的列表(带有功能组件)和删除项目的能力 两个项目之间的拖拽 拖拽投票组件,拖动至指定容器,位置互换
react-beautiful-dnd(2)简单demo测试
1.纵向组件拖拽 2.横向拖拽 3.代办事项拓展 3.1初始数据源todoData 3.2DragDropContext 3.2多项任务Droppable 3.3拖拽项Draggable
下一页
个人成就
文章被点赞
33
文章被阅读
59,781
掘力值
1,326
关注了
17
关注者
16
收藏集
43
关注标签
4
加入于
2021-06-17